Could you help us coordinate fundraising collections in your community? Marie Curie is currently looking for Collection Hosts in Swansea, Neath & Port Talbot to help us run our collections in local supermarkets, garden centres, high streets and other local venues. Your local Community Fundraiser will liaise with you regarding what sites and dates you are able to support us with, typically these are Feb-April for our Great Daffodil Appeal and we also run summer/autumn collection and Christmas collections depending on site availability.

Collection Hosts will complete the following tasks:

  • Liaise with the local fundraising team regarding the logistics of the collection day.
  • Raise awareness of the collection locally to assist with collector recruitment to help fill rotas. This could be on social media pages or your own contacts.
  • Build relationships with the venues and help to secure dates of future collections.
  • Contact volunteers before the collection to confirm arrangements for the day.
  • Be the main point of contact for volunteers on the day of our collections, giving out materials and answering questions to ensure the best experience for collectors.
  • Process income after the collection in line with the relevant Marie Curie and venue policies. This can include banking money, processing paperwork and thanking the store and volunteers.

Full training will be provided, and you will be given the tools to help you in your role, for example collection materials and an ID card.

For this role you should be:

  • Organised
  • Have great communication skills

This is a flexible role, and we will try where possible to source the best dates for collections that fit around you but this will be dependent on site availability.
